The CMR04E270JPDR is a high-reliability mica capacitor from Cornell Dubilier Electronics (CDE), part of the CMR04 series. It offers a capacitance of 27 pF with a ±5% tolerance and a voltage rating of 500V DC. The dielectric material is mica, providing stable capacitance over temperature and frequency.
This capacitor is designed for through-hole mounting in a radial package with a lead spacing of 3.80 mm. Its dimensions are 9.40 mm length, 4.80 mm width, and 8.40 mm height. It operates over a wide temperature range of -55°C to 150°C, making it suitable for demanding environments.
The CMR series meets the requirements of MIL-PRF-39001 for high-reliability applications, including ground, airborne, and space-borne systems. The capacitor is dipped silvered mica construction, ensuring excellent performance in critical circuits.
RoHS3 compliant (unverified) and REACH unaffected, this component is suitable for general purpose applications where high stability and reliability are required.
